
Burnley ended Liverpool’s three-year unbeaten run in the Premier League at Anfield on Thursday after Ashley Barnes converted an 83rd-minute penalty for a 1-0 win. In a one-on-one challenge for the ball, Barnes was tripped by Liverpool goalkeeper Alisson’s hand and, after the referee pointed to the spot, Barnes confidently dispatched the winner. “We knew if we kept believing we would get something,” said Barnes. “We believe going into every game, we stayed resilient and in our shape and it paid off.
